Diabetes and Heart DiseaseIf you have diabetes, you are more at risk for heart disease and stroke. Why? High blood sugar over time candamage your heart and blood vessels.Now for the good news: Many of the things you do to manage your diabetes can also lower your risk for heartdisease and stroke.These include: being physically active, choosing healthy foods, and maintaining a healthy weight.This program is for informational purposes only.
